The Issue

The recent decision to strip Firestar73 of his title as the Orlando Pokémon Regional Champion is an alarming overreach. This ruling not only undermines the spirit of competitive play but also penalizes a player who showed genuine passion for the game. Firestar73 was issued a retrospective game loss for supposed "unsportsmanlike behavior" after he momentarily celebrated a hard-fought win by removing his headset and shaking an opponent's hand—actions that are the essence of sportsmanship and respect in any competitive setting.

For those unfamiliar with the events, Firestar73's disqualification came after he had already secured his rightful victory, during a moment of genuine joy and celebration—a spontaneous reflex in the world of competitive Pokémon. To censor expressions of joy in such a manner is to rob players of the emotional validation that comes from their countless hours of dedication, training, and sacrifice.

We all know that in competitive environments, emotions run high, and celebrations are a natural outcome of success. Punishing a champion, who acted with the utmost respect towards his opponent post-victory, sends a negative message that players must suppress genuine expressions of happiness. This not only impacts Firestar73 but sets an alarming precedent that could stifle the passionate culture of the competitive Pokémon GO community.

Firestar73 deserves to be reinstated as the Orlando Champion not just for his impressive performance but to preserve the integrity and spirit of the game we all cherish. Such extreme disciplinary actions not only harm individual players but threaten to diminish the authenticity of competitive play. Allowing players to express their victories humanely and responsibly should resonate with the values of community and camaraderie that Pokémon events have long championed.

We call on the tournament officials to review this misguided decision and reinstate Firestar73's well-earned title.
